#1e0c11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e0c11 is composed of 11.8% red, 4.7%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 88.2% black. It has a hue angle of 343.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 8.2%. #1e0c11 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c1822 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

● #1e0c11 color description : Very dark (mostly black) pink.
#1e0c11 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e0c11 has RGB values of R:30, G:12,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.43, K:0.88. Its decimal value is 1969169.
